Transaction 2c5a2038d3892886b239182b75ce6b33d51499698bfef6dadfc0c0b28a19d88e
1 Input
1 Output
-
2c5a2038d3892886b239182b75ce6b33d51499698bfef6dadfc0c0b28a19d88e:0
- value
- 40766102
- script pubkey
- OP_0 OP_PUSHBYTES_20 5632b0392452ab8dce5bbd7f7995f7414b86290d
- address
- bc1q2cetqwfy224cmnjmh4lhn90hg99cv2gdtra5p4